how to convert german charater in to utf string in pdf parsing in iphone? -
how to convert german charater in to utf string in pdf parsing in iphone? -
i have implementing pdf parsing in have parsed pdf , fetch text disply junks characters want convert in utf string.how possible please help me question.
first, need find out encoding used text. guess it's iso-8859-1, aka latin-1 or it's variant iso-8859-15, aka latin-15.
as know it's piece of cake. haven't said in container got text, e.g. whether it's stored in c string or nsdata.
let's assume got c string. in case do:
mystring = [[nsstring alloc] initwithbytes:mycstring length:strlen(mycstring) encoding:nsisolatin1stringencoding];
if got nsdata, utilize initwithdata:encoding:
initializer instead. that's need do, according apple's documentation, "a string object presents array of unicode characters". if need utf8-encoded c string, can query via:
myutf8cstring = [mystring utf8string];
there's datausingencoding:
nsdata object instead of c string.
have @ nsstring class reference , nsstringencoding constants.
iphone
Comments
Post a Comment